Table 3. Analysis of the Relationship of β-tubulin Genotype with Patient and Parasitological Independent Variables Before Treatment.

N = 183 female worms OR 95% CI p
Age of patient 0.97 0.93–1.00 0.081
No. females/nod. 0.94 0.73–1.21 0.629
CMFL 41–60 mf/ss 0.81 0.13–5.15 0.819
CMFL 61–70 mf/ss 1.93 0.44–8.49 0.385
CMFL 71–114 mf/ss 0.44 0.06–3.15 0.413
No. nod. 1994 1.00 0.81–1.22 0.976

Odds ratios (OR) and 95% confidence intervals (95% CI) for logistic regression of heterozygote status (vs. homozygote) of worms collected before ivermectin treatment on four independent variables. No. females/nod. = total number of females in the nodule; No. nod. 1994 = total number of palpable nodules in 1994; CMFL = Community Microfilarial Load (reference category: 10–40 microfilariae per skin snip (mf/ss)).
